Description

Vulnerability in the Application Express Team Calendar Plugin product of Oracle Application Express (component: User Account). Supported versions that are affected are Application Express Team Calendar Plugin: 18.2-22.1. Easily exploitable vulnerability allows low privileged attacker with network access via HTTP to compromise Application Express Team Calendar Plugin. Successful attacks require human interaction from a person other than the attacker and while the vulnerability is in Application Express Team Calendar Plugin, attacks may significantly impact additional products (scope change). Successful attacks of this vulnerability can result in takeover of Application Express Team Calendar Plugin. CVSS 3.1 Base Score 9.0 (Confidentiality, Integrity and Availability impacts). CVSS Vector: (C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:L/UI:R/S:C/C:H/I:H/A:H).
